State Law: No Hand-Held Phone Use By Driver

State law prohibits drivers from using hand-held phones while driving.

Reinforces a state hand-held cell phone ban: drivers may not hold a phone to talk, text, or use apps while operating the vehicle. Hands-free devices are typically permitted for adult drivers, but check the state's specific rules; many states ban any phone use by novice drivers. Penalties include fines and points.
